The Whisper of History: Celery’s Ancient Roots and Evolving Reverence
Before delving into the molecular marvels, it’s essential to appreciate celery’s long and storied past. Its lineage traces back to ancient marshlands, with wild ancestors (Apium graveolens) found across Europe and Asia. Unlike the cultivated celery we know today, these wild varieties were more bitter and fibrous, yet their medicinal properties were recognized millennia ago.
The ancient Egyptians revered celery, not primarily as a food, but for its purported medicinal and symbolic qualities. Fragments of celery have been found in the tomb of Pharaoh Tutankhamun, suggesting its use in funerary rituals, perhaps symbolizing rejuvenation or eternal life. The Greeks, too, wove celery into their cultural fabric, associating it with athletic prowess and using its leaves to crown victors in games like the Isthmian Games, akin to the laurel wreaths of the Olympics. Hippocrates, the father of medicine, is said to have prescribed celery for nervousness, a testament to its calming properties recognized even then.
In Roman times, celery was incorporated more into cuisine, yet its medicinal reputation persisted. Across various traditional medicine systems, from Ayurvedic to Traditional Chinese Medicine (TCM), celery has been consistently employed for its diuretic effects, to reduce inflammation, lower blood pressure, and alleviate symptoms of various ailments, including arthritis and gout. Understanding the Kidney’s Role: The Body’s Master Filter
To appreciate celery’s diuretic action, one must first grasp the critical role of the kidneys. These two bean-shaped organs are the body’s sophisticated filtration system. Every day, they filter about 180 liters of blood, removing waste products, excess salts, and water, while reabsorbing essential nutrients. The functional units of the kidney, called nephrons, are responsible for this intricate process, involving glomerular filtration, tubular reabsorption, and tubular secretion. Diuretics, whether natural or synthetic, essentially enhance the excretion of water and sodium by influencing these nephron processes.
The Key Players: Bioactive Compounds in Celery
Celery’s diuretic prowess isn’t attributable to a single compound but rather a synergistic blend, a chemical orchestra where each component plays a vital role:
-
Phthalides: These organic compounds are arguably the stars of celery’s diuretic show. Specifically, compounds like 3-n-butylphthalide (3nB) and sedanenolide are well-researched. Phthalides are believed to exert their diuretic effect through several mechanisms:
- Vascular Smooth Muscle Relaxation: Phthalides have demonstrated the ability to relax the smooth muscles surrounding blood vessels, particularly arteries. This vasodilation leads to a reduction in peripheral vascular resistance, which in turn can lower blood pressure. When blood pressure in the kidneys is optimally regulated, it can enhance glomerular filtration rate (GFR), thereby increasing urine output.
- Direct Renal Effects (Hypothesized): While not as strongly established as the vascular effects, some research suggests phthalides might have a direct influence on kidney tubules, potentially inhibiting sodium reabsorption, similar to the action of some pharmaceutical diuretics, albeit much milder. This would lead to increased sodium and water excretion.
-
Flavonoids: Celery is rich in various flavonoids, potent plant pigments with significant antioxidant and anti-inflammatory properties. Key flavonoids include apigenin, luteolin, and quercetin. While their primary roles are often highlighted for their antioxidant capacity, several flavonoids are known to possess mild diuretic activity.
- Apigenin and Luteolin: These particular flavonoids have been studied for their potential to inhibit enzymes involved in sodium reabsorption in the kidneys, leading to increased sodium and water excretion. They may also contribute to vasodilation, indirectly supporting kidney function and filtration.
- Synergistic Action: Flavonoids often work in concert with other compounds. Their anti-inflammatory properties can reduce stress on the kidneys, optimizing their filtering capacity and indirectly supporting diuresis.
-
Potassium: Often overlooked, celery is a good source of potassium, an essential electrolyte. While high sodium intake is associated with fluid retention, potassium acts as a natural antagonist to sodium, promoting its excretion from the body.
- Electrolyte Balance: Potassium plays a crucial role in maintaining fluid and electrolyte balance within cells and throughout the body. A higher potassium intake can help shift the balance towards increased sodium and water excretion via the kidneys, thereby contributing to diuresis. This is a fundamental principle of renal physiology, and celery’s potassium content aligns perfectly with this mechanism.
-
High Water Content: This is the most straightforward, yet highly effective, aspect of celery’s diuretic profile. Composed of over 95% water, celery naturally contributes to overall fluid intake. When the body is well-hydrated, the kidneys are better able to perform their filtration duties efficiently. Increased fluid intake itself stimulates urine production, helping to flush out waste products and prevent fluid stagnation. It’s a simple, elegant mechanism that underpins much of celery’s refreshing effect.

Important Considerations and Cautions:
While celery is generally safe and beneficial for most individuals, a knowledgeable approach includes awareness of potential caveats:
- Allergies: Celery is a known allergen for some individuals, particularly those with pollen-food allergy syndrome (oral allergy syndrome) due to cross-reactivity with birch pollen. Symptoms can range from mild (itching in the mouth) to severe (anaphylaxis).
- Pesticide Residue: Celery is often on the Environmental Working Group’s (EWG) "Dirty Dozen" list, indicating a higher likelihood of pesticide residues due to its porous nature and farming practices. Whenever possible, choose organic celery to minimize exposure to pesticides. If organic isn’t available, thorough washing is crucial.
- Medication Interactions:
- Diuretics: Individuals on prescription diuretics should consult their doctor before significantly increasing celery intake, as the combined effect could potentially lead to excessive fluid loss or electrolyte imbalances.
- Blood Thinners (Anticoagulants): Celery is a good source of Vitamin K, which plays a role in blood clotting. While moderate intake is unlikely to cause issues, very high consumption could theoretically interfere with blood-thinning medications like warfarin. Always discuss significant dietary changes with your healthcare provider if you are on such medications.
- Blood Pressure Medications: Given celery’s blood pressure-lowering effects, those on antihypertensive medications should monitor their blood pressure closely and consult their doctor about potential additive effects.
- Oxalates: Celery contains oxalates, natural compounds found in many plants. For individuals prone to kidney stones (especially calcium oxalate stones), very high intake of oxalate-rich foods might be a concern. However, celery’s overall benefits typically outweigh this for most people, and adequate hydration (which celery promotes) is key to preventing stone formation.
- Photosensitivity (Rare): Certain compounds in celery (furocoumarins) can increase photosensitivity in some individuals, particularly if they handle large quantities of celery (e.g., farm workers) and are then exposed to strong sunlight, leading to skin irritation or rashes (phytophotodermatitis). This is generally not a concern for typical dietary consumption.
